Transaction 543518325ffcc2988df965f8f1d33391fc1762e5b808c9148f39fea4311e08c1

1 Input
2 Outputs
  • 543518325ffcc2988df965f8f1d33391fc1762e5b808c9148f39fea4311e08c1:0
  • value  50000000
    address  3E8s5ipsLiveArpW5JsxRiQQXjyXZVPr8x
  • 543518325ffcc2988df965f8f1d33391fc1762e5b808c9148f39fea4311e08c1:1
  • value  1680929110
    address  3DM7vozM9PoijVZFVQ68PoLQa3tCDkxMya